Station Facilities and Services

While Lawrence Hill does not boast a grand array of facilities, it meets the essential needs of its passengers. The station does not have a ticket office, but don't worry; ticket machines are available for pur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ets. If you require assistance, customer help points are conveniently positioned, and there's an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ments.

It's worth noting that full step-free access is limited due to the layout. Access to Platform 1 is available via a supermarket car park, while Platform 2 requires navigating a step bridge, categorizing Lawrence Hill as a step-free B3 station.

Although missing certain conveniences such as refreshment facilities, toilets, and waiting rooms, the station ensures basic security with CCTV coverage and seating areas available for passengers to rest while waiting for their train.

Facilities at Romiley Station

Romiley station boasts a range of facilities to ensure comfort and accessibility for all passengers.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ening on weekdays and Saturdays, although it remains closed on Sundays. While online ticket collection is currently unavailable, ticket machines, including accessible options, are present. The station is equipped with an induction loop, benefitting those with hearing impairments. CCTV cameras add an extra layer of security.

Although Romiley station doesn’t offer extensive dining or shopping options, ample amenities nearby on Stockport Road make up for it, offering something to grab on the way. Additionally, the station does not have waiting rooms or baby changing facilities, but seating areas are provided for comfort.

Accessibility and Assistance

Many travelers appreciate Romiley station’s part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ility challenges. With ramps available for some parts of the station, traveling to and from Manchester has been significantly simplified. However, there are no accessible toilets or dedicated accessibility personnel on site. But worry not, assistance can be arranged through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ring everyone can navigate their journey comfortably. Transport Links and Connectivity

Transport connectivity is a prime highlight of Romiley station. Besides seamless train connections, its integration with local bus services makes onward travel convenient. Bus stops located on Stockport Road offer routes to nearby cities like Manchester and Stockport. While bicycle enthusiasts may find the cycle hire unavailable, safe spaces for bike storage are available within the station car park. For taxis, Northern Railway's Cab4You service can be of assistance for easy booking options.
